Roofing Leadwork in Tunbridge Wells

Leadwork involves the use of lead to seal and waterproof different parts of your roof. It’s commonly used in flashings, valleys, and other areas where water might seep in. Lead is durable, flexible, and can last for many years when installed correctly. Lead has been used in roofing for centuries because of its unmatched durability and flexibility. It can be shaped to fit complex structures and provides a long-lasting seal against water infiltration. This makes it a preferred material for roofing leadwork.

Common Tumble Dryer Problems and Solutions

Even with proper care, tumble dryers can encounter issues over time. Knowing how to identify and address these problems can save you a lot of trouble. Here are some common issues and their solutions:

 

Dryer Not Heating Up

If your tumble dryer isn’t generating heat, it could be due to a faulty heating element, thermostat, or thermal fuse. Check these components for any visible damage or wear and replace them if necessary. If you’re not confident doing this yourself, Ace Installations can provide expert assistance.

 

Unusual Noises

Strange sounds like grinding, squeaking, or thumping usually indicate worn-out drum bearings, belts, or rollers. Regularly inspect these parts and lubricate or replace them as needed to keep your dryer running quietly and smoothly.

 

Clothes Taking Too Long to Dry

When your dryer takes longer than usual to dry clothes, it could be due to a clogged lint filter or vent. Clean these areas thoroughly to improve airflow. Additionally, ensure the moisture sensor is clean and functioning correctly.

 

DIY Maintenance Tips

Taking care of your tumble dryer doesn’t always require professional help. Here are some simple DIY maintenance tips to keep your appliance in top shape:

 

Regular Cleaning

Clean the lint filter after every use to prevent build-up. Every few months, vacuum the dryer vent to remove any accumulated lint and debris. This not only improves efficiency but also reduces fire risks.

 

Inspect and Tighten

Periodically check all screws, bolts, and other fasteners to ensure they’re secure. Loose parts can cause vibrations and noise, affecting the dryer’s performance.

 

Check the Ventilation System

Ensure the dryer’s ventilation system is clear and unobstructed. Proper ventilation is crucial for efficient drying and preventing overheating.

Facts About Felt And Fibreglass!

The most favoured roofing systems for flat roofs (and some pitched roofs) are fibreglass and felt. Both have their benefits, although felt is more affordable as a material. However, their lifespans can vary, with felt lasting under 10 years and fibreglass lasting 20 or over. Even with a shorter lifespan, felt is still beneficial in several ways. For instance, felt (being traditional as a roofing system for flat roofs) is difficult to pass through once fitted properly, as well as having a high viscosity. This type of roofing has been used for many years due to the cheaper cost and reliability. It is also fast to fit and replace if there is an issue. It is also easy to transport to different locations, due to how easy it is to handle. These days felt has a 3-layer membrane, which helps it to keep fighting against the elements. Buildings that can benefit from a felt roof are smaller ones like porches or garages.

 

Another material that is popular is fibreglass. This roofing system is stronger than felt. Due to not having any seams, water is unlikely to sneak through, which makes repair work easier to manage. It is also defensive against chemicals and heat, which makes it a great choice safety wise. As fibreglass is more durable than felt, larger buildings will benefit from it more. World Green Roof Day 2022

Did you know that on the 6th June each year, it is World Green Roof Day? This day is in celebration of all the greens roofs in the world and their benefits to both the environment and people, particularly in towns or cities. Having a green roof means your property will keep a regular temperature, keeping it warm in the colder months and cooler during the summer. This will decrease energy bills and lower the need to use heating or air conditioners! The vegetation that grows on top of these roofs are beneficial due to providing a natural habitat for plant life and small creatures, helping with biodiversity. Vegetation also helps with the reduction of both dust and pollutants, due to the improvement of air quality.

 

Visually, having a green roof means your property will blend in with the scenery, giving it a lovely aesthetic boost. In turn, a green roof will help to improve the building value in an eco-friendly way, improving the carbon footprint and reducing noise issues. The Importance Of Restoring A Period House Roof

The roof of your period property should be a priority. Due to the delicate nature of the building, you do not want any damp to occur, due to the risk of it leaking through and causing damage to the interior, such as the wood and ceiling. If this happens then you can get decay from damp, which could develop into a very expensive issue.

 

Period houses should be checked at least twice in the year, although you can keep an eye out for problems yourself. By walking around the property, you can check nothing has fallen from the roof, such as slate. If any tiles are missing, or there’s any damage to the property (such as corrosion of the flashing) this needs to be sorted as soon as possible. Any repairs needed should be done by a professional who has experience with period houses, particularly if there are any structural issues. Restoration needs to be thought about carefully and safely. For instance, if the timbers have issues (such as rotting) then you can’t just have a new roof put on due to the lack of support. Also, you may worry that changing the material of the roof will limit the original quality, but old materials might be hindering the health and safety of the property. You need to keep protecting the property, so materials like fibreglass can be a good option. Does Your Chimney Need Repairing?

There are a few things to look out for when you aren’t sure if your chimney needs work. Cracks and deterioration are the more obvious signs of damage on the stack of the chimney. Bad weather can cause wear and tear and masonry to weather and crumble. If you see this happening and any cracks appearing, then you need to get a professional straight away. Cracks can have frozen water within them in the colder months, which can cause it to expand, causing more issues.

 

There may be interior issues that you need to keep an eye out for. For instance, leaks can appear in the form of staining on the walls and ceiling under the chimney. A leak can happen when there are bad quality flashings and damaged gutters. This can create moisture in the room which can lead to fungus and mould growing in the timber of the roof. Often this can be helped by fitting excellent quality lead flashing.

 

You may find if there is a problem with the chimney pot, mess and rainwater can drip down the chimney flue. If there any cracks, damp can come through causing flue issues. This can be shown from any rust that may appear. A new flue liner could help to defend against this, as well as help insulation.

 

You may notice your chimney is leaning slightly, which may not necessarily be a worry for old chimneys, but it could indicate issues with the mortar joints. If this is the case then you need a professional to check and confirm whether or not it needs stabilising, or taking down and being rebuilt, as it may be unsafe to keep up. Why Should You Get a Velux Window?

Velux windows have several benefits. One particular benefit of a Velux window being fitted is how the air circulation will improve. ‘VE’ in Velux stands for ‘ventilation’, as the atmosphere inside your home will boost considerably with the fresh, crisp air. Improving the air circulation will help to lower the possibility of condensation, which is one reason for damp.

 

‘LUX’ means ‘light’ in Latin. Velux windows have frames which are created to be narrow, which allows as much natural light as possible to come through. Natural light is generally preferred to artificial light, as it can help boost moods and improve health physically and mentally.

 

Aesthetically Velux windows are stylish, with several design ideas available to complement the existing home features. The natural light flooding in will make the area feel bigger and more spacious.

 

Due to the extra light coming in, you won’t need to switch the lights on as often. This means a reduction on electric costs, making it financially efficient. Velux windows also have great insulation abilities in the colder months, helping to keep your heating costs down and your family and home warm. Do Your Gutters Need Replacing?

Gutters are essential on buildings, as they redirect water from rain so it flows carefully down and away from the house through a drainpipe, therefore reducing the risk of damp and leaks, and the symptoms that may appear from them such as mould and erosions.

 

Water needs to be able to flow smoothly and any hazards such as cracks and holes can cause it to leak out on to the walls instead. If this happens the gutters needs replacing pretty swiftly, particularly if there are stains, mould, or any evidence of erosion. Mould on a lower floor can also indicate problems with the gutter.

 

Gutters are meant to be fitted close to the building, so if you notice any bending or bowing pieces that look under strain, then replacement may have to be an option.

 

A regular clean and inspection of the gutter can help to prevent any blockages that may occur. Make sure you use a Leadwork specialist

Lead has been used as a roofing material for over 200 years and is still in use today. Repairing and restoring lead work requires a lead work specialist who can accurately identify the problem and use their expertise to repair or if necessary renew the faulty area.

 

Lead flashing around chimneys and guttering or at junctions between roofs are problematic and should be tackled by a qualified craftsman. Particularly in cases where it is necessary to use heat to repair the area. Arranging an inspection report for your roof if you are concerned about its condition is an excellent first step. Roof Repairs in Tunbridge Wells

Small leaks can cause big problems, dealing with them right away can prevent mould, rotting, destroyed insulation and damaged ceilings. If you have water stains that extend across ceilings or run-down walls, the cause is probably a leaky roof and should definitely be taken care of sooner rather than later.

 

Penetrations in the roof are the most common source of leaks, interrupted shingles, plumbing and roof vents are some of the causes of water damage. Look for black marks, mould and water-stains to find the source. If you are struggling to find the problem area, try wetting the roof from the outside with a garden hose and have someone wait inside for water to come through. Ensuring things like roof vents are properly secured to the roof with no damage to the rubber casing or missing screws can be a simple solution to preventing leaks.
